About
Stitched strings together the thrilling story of Catherine Stockholmes, an otherwise ordinary girl. The story begins with Catherine waking up in an eerie doll factory. With a great desire to escape, Catherine is forced to venture through the factory. But little does she know that terrible fates always befall the curious ones. Will Catherine muster enough courage to needle her way out of the factory? Or will she fall into shear despair and perish? Features - Compelling story - Unsettling atmosphere - Meticulously detailed, hand drawn cut scenes - Thoroughly developed characters - Heart-stopping chase sequences - A variety of engaging puzzles

Stitched — Session FAQ
- How long does a session of Stitched take?
- The minimum meaningful session for Stitched is approximately 15 minutes. This is the shortest play window where you can make real progress or have a satisfying experience, based on community data.
- Can you pause Stitched?
- Stitched uses save points or manual saves. You'll need to reach a checkpoint before exiting to avoid losing progress — factor this into your session planning.
- Does Stitched pressure you to keep playing?
- Stitched has no FOMO mechanics — no timed events, live content, or narrative cliffhangers. You can stop whenever you want without feeling like you're missing out.
- What is Stitched's Session Respect Score?
- Stitched has a Session Respect Score of 7.5/10. This score combines minimum session length, pausability, FOMO level, and pickup friendliness into a single metric for how well the game fits busy schedules.
